Bloomberg Arts Internship | Bloomberg Philanthropies | ELIGIBLE TO RISING HIGH SCHOOL SENIORS ONLY! Sitar Arts Center is proud to be the DC home of the Bloomberg Arts Internship program. In this program rising high school seniors complete well paid summer internships at local arts and culture organizations three days a week and participate in workforce development and college readiness training two days a week. Launched in 2012 in New York City, the Bloomberg Arts Internship helps set up the next generation for success as they transition from high school to college and the workforce — whether in the arts or other industries. Nationally, the program has … | Internship, Summer Program | 03/16/2025 |

Men's College Scholarship | Foundation for Fraternal Excellence | The scholarship is designed to identify and reward outstanding high school seniors who have demonstrated an ability to excel in the fields of academics, extra-curricular school activities and community involvement. The scholarship is available to any male, graduating high school senior who is enrolling in a four-year undergraduate college program that commences in the fall of 2025. The scholarship is awarded through the Foundation for Fraternal Excellence, a registered 501(c)3 organization. REQUIREMENTS: Must be a graduating high school senior in the United States Must identify as male Must have access to a U.S. bank account (for direct fund deposit if … | Scholarship | 04/01/2025 |
Georgetown’s Future Global Leaders Fellowship | Georgetown University School of Foreign Service | Georgetown’s Future Global Leaders Fellowship Application deadline: Sunday, March 2, 2025 This summer, we will once again offer full scholarships for students from the greater Washington, DC and Baltimore, MD areas to participate in our global affairs programs. At no cost to students or their families, Fellows will have the opportunity to apply for one of the following Summer Academies: International Relations Academy (June 22-28, 2025) or (July 20-26, 2025) Washington & the World Academy (July 27-August 2, 2025) Fellows will learn from renowned faculty, examine existing and emerging global challenges, and learn how they can become involved in the … | Summer Program | 03/02/2025 |
